Frozen Fruit and Cereal Yogurt Bites

​For a healthy, portable breakfast, stick your muffin tin in the freezer, not the oven! Fill your muffin tin to the brim with healthy fresh fruit, Greek yogurt, and cereal for a granola-like parfait that freezes into perfectly-portioned frozen breakfast bites.

Ingredients
- 1 to 2 bananas (cut into 1/4-inch thick slices)
- 1 1/4 cups whole milk Greek yogurt
- 1/3 cup cereal or granola
- 1/4 cup assorted fresh fruit (chopped)
Steps to Make It
-
Depending on how big your muffin tin is, place 1 to 3 banana slices in the bottom of each cup. If you make these in a regular-sized muffin tin, you won’t fill the ingredients to the top.
-
Top the bananas with a dollop of Greek yogurt. You can also use a freezer bag as a piping bag to carefully pipe in the yogurt for a more polished look. Next, add some cereal and fresh fruit.
-
Freeze for about 2 hours or until solid.
